Attracting sellout crowds, from families to celebrities, the renowned Barnsdall Friday Night Wine Tastings—the Foundation’s signature fundraising event—returned to the hill this summer on Memorial Day and continues through Labor Day Weekend. Barnsdall Park hosts’ evenings of fine wine and art in the gardens of Frank Lloyd Wright’s newly restored architectural gem, Hollyhock House.

8

This summer, ongoing partner, Silverlake Wine, continues curating fine selections of boutique, small production, artisanal wines for park-goers as well as local gourmet cheese shop, Say Cheese. Art workshops for children, music by KCRW’s DJ Dan Wilcox and a host of specialty food trucks, also compliment this popular family-friendly event that has raised over $500K to support the Park’s capital projects, art programs, historic renovations and gallery exhibitions over the last six years.

7

At this beautiful spot overlooking the City, Barnsdall Park will welcome Angelenos to sip wine, picnic, enjoy the panoramic views and watch the sunset for another not-to-be-missed season of wine, food, and art at this iconic cultural destination. With the reopening of Frank Lloyd Wright’s iconic Hollyhock House, one of the nice new features of this year’s fundraiser is the curator-led tours of the house for an additional $12.

Considered the recreational crown jewel of the Santa Monica Mountains, Malibu Creek State Park has over 8,000 acres of rolling tallgrass plains, oak savannah’s, and dramatic peaks. It’s no wonder many call it “The Yosemite of Southern California.”

m1

There are 15 miles of streamside trail through oak and sycamore woodlands and chaparral-covered slopes. After a good rain, namesake Malibu Creek comes to life.

m2

The park, formerly owned by 20th Century Fox Studios, opened in 1976 and has welcomed millions of visitors since. The stunning terrain here that has been seen all over the world in movies and television awaits you. Come hike, ride, climb, and explore L.A.’s most spectacular park!

Downtown Burbank is revving up for the 4th annual Downtown Burbank Car Classic. Highlights include the Red Carpet Expo focusing on celebrity vehicles from film and television, along with a display of legendary cars from the Warner Bros. Studio Tour Hollywood, The Television Motion Picture Car Club, World Famous West Coast Customs, and more.

3b

Additional blocks will feature 200 restored and pre-1974 vehicles, custom cars, family entertainment, music by KCRW DJ Gary Calamar, and automotive-related booths. The Downtown Burbank Car Classic is free and open to the public.

6b

7b

The Downtown Burbank Car Classic will take place on four blocks outdoors on San Fernando Boulevard between Magnolia Boulevard and Angeleno Avenue. The Red Carpet Expo will be located between Angeleno and Olive Avenues in Downtown Burbank.
